"An Easy Approach to Software Engineering (PM Series) 3rd Edition" is a comprehensive guide designed for students, professionals, and beginners looking to understand the concepts of software engineering in an approachable and straightforward manner. Written by C.M. Aslam, Aqsa Aslam, Dr. Iftikhar Ahmed, and Riaz Shahid, this book covers essential topics in software engineering with a focus on simplifying complex concepts. The third edition brings updated content, keeping up with the latest trends and best practices in the field.
